The lanthanides are in period 6, the actinides in the 7th period. Periods are numbered vertically (down from the top) but run across the Periodic Table in rows. The columns, sometimes called "groups", are numbered horizontally from left to right but actually run from top to bottom. The lanthanides and actinides are all in column 3, but, because they take up so much room in the periodic table, are placed below it.,

There are seven periods on the periodic table. The lanthanides are in period 6, and the actinides are in period 7.
The first period is at the top of the table. It consists of hydrogen and helium. The bottom period is period 7.
